密码、指纹、生物识别:现代保险柜解锁技术解析
在现代社会,保险柜作为一种保护贵重物品安全的设备,其解锁技术也日益发展。本文将针对密码、指纹以及生物识别这三种现代保险柜解锁技术进行详细解析。
一、密码解锁技术
密码解锁技术是保险柜最常用的解锁方式之一。用户通过输入正确的密码来开启保险柜。密码可以是数字、字母或混合字符的组合,其复杂度越高,破解难度越大。为了保障安全性,现代保险柜通常采用多位数密码,并支持多种密码输入方式,如虚拟键盘、触摸屏等。此外,一些高端保险柜还采用了动态密码或生物特征识别与密码结合的方式,提高了开锁的安全性。

二、指纹解锁技术
指纹解锁技术是一种基于人体生物特征的识别方式。保险柜通过读取用户的指纹信息,与预先存储的指纹模板进行比对,以确定是否匹配。由于每个人的指纹都是独一无二的,因此指纹解锁技术具有较高的安全性。此外,指纹解锁技术操作简便,用户只需将手指轻轻放在指纹识别器上即可完成开锁。然而,指纹识别也存在一定局限性,如指纹磨损、假指等可能影响识别效果。
三、生物识别解锁技术
生物识别解锁技术是近年来发展迅速的一种解锁方式。与指纹识别相比,生物识别技术涵盖了更广泛的领域,如面部识别、虹膜识别、声纹识别等。这些技术通过捕捉用户的生物特征信息进行比对,以实现开锁目的。生物识别技术具有较高的准确性和安全性,且不易被复制或盗用。然而,生物识别技术也存在一定挑战,如技术成本较高、对环境光线和角度的要求等。

Password, Fingerprint, and Biometric Identification: An Analysis of Modern Safe Unlocking Technologies
In modern society, as a device to protect valuable items, the unlocking technology of safes is constantly evolving. This article will provide a detailed analysis of the three modern safe unlocking technologies: password, fingerprint, and biometric identification.
I. Password Unlocking Technology
Password unlocking technology is one of the most commonly used methods for opening safes. Users unlock the safe by entering the correct password, which can be a combination of numbers, letters, or mixed characters. The higher the complexity of the password, the more difficult it is to crack. To ensure security, modern safes often use multi-digit passwords and support multiple password input methods, such as virtual keyboards and touch screens. Additionally, some high-end safes adopt dynamic passwords or a combination of biometric identification and passwords, which enhances the security of unlocking.
II. Fingerprint Unlocking Technology
Fingerprint unlocking technology is a type of biometric identification based on human biological features. The safe reads the user's fingerprint information and compares it with a pre-stored fingerprint template to determine if there is a match. Since each person's fingerprint is unique, fingerprint unlocking technology provides a high level of security. Furthermore, fingerprint unlocking is easy to operate, as the user simply places their finger on the fingerprint reader to complete the unlocking process. However, fingerprint recognition has certain limitations, such as fingerprint wear and fake fingers, which may affect recognition accuracy.

III. Biometric Identification Unlocking Technology
Biometric identification unlocking technology is a rapidly developing method in recent years. Compared to fingerprint recognition, biometric identification technology covers a broader range of fields, such as facial recognition, iris recognition, voiceprint recognition, etc. These technologies capture the user's biometric information for comparison to achieve the purpose of unlocking. Biometric identification technology offers high accuracy and security and is not easily replicated or stolen. However, it also poses certain challenges, such as high technological costs and requirements for environmental lighting and angles.
